是否可以同时提供对git子模块的https和ssh访问?有些人可能更喜欢使用https而有些人可能只能使用ssh(例如,因为他们在ssh隧道后面)。是否可以提供两种获取子模块的选项? 最佳答案 您可以在引用子模块时使用相对URL。例如,如果您有一个应用程序存储库:git@example.org:project/app.git或http://example.org/git/project/app.git和一个库存储库:git@example.org:lib/some-library.git或http://example.org/git
这是我做的:我运行了gitcheckout-bbranch_name。我在branch_name上做了一些提交。我检查了master分支并进行了快速merge。当我运行gitlogbranch_name--oneline时,我收到以下消息:fatal:ambiguousargument'branch_name':bothrevisionandfilenameUse'--'toseparatepathsfromrevisions,likethis:'git[...]--[...]'可能是什么问题? 最佳答案 它告诉您您有一个名为“br
我遇到了一些问题,不知道在mysqli_stmt_execute之后调用什么以及什么时候调用你怎么知道什么时候打电话mysqli_stmt_bind_resultmysqli_stmt_store_resultmysqli_stmt_fetch 最佳答案 mysqli_stmt_bind_result()告诉mysqli在获取行时要填充哪个变量,但它还没有fetch()任何内容。在调用fetch之前,必须调用一次。mysqli_stmt_store_result()设置了一个可选行为,以便客户端在您fetch()第一行时下载所有行,
我刚刚使用mysqli将我所有的sql查询更改为准备好的语句。为了加快这个过程,我创建了一个函数(称为performQuery)来代替mysql_query。它接受查询、绑定(bind)(如“sdss”)和要传入的变量,然后执行所有准备好的语句。这意味着更改我所有的旧代码很容易。我的函数使用mysqliget_result()返回一个mysqli_result对象。这意味着我可以更改我的旧代码:$query="SELECTxFROMyWHEREz=$var";$result=mysql_query($query);while($row=mysql_fetch_assoc($result
想知道如何将PHP准备语句的结果绑定(bind)到数组中,然后如何调用它们。例如这个查询$q=$DBH->prepare("SELECT*FROMusersWHEREusername=?");$q->bind_param("s",$user);$q->execute();这将返回用户名、电子邮件和ID的结果。想知道我是否可以将它绑定(bind)到一个数组中,然后将它存储在一个变量中以便我可以在整个页面中调用它? 最佳答案 引入PHP5.3mysqli_stmt::get_result,它返回一个结果集对象。然后您可以调用mysqli
我是PHP的新手,我意识到我的数据库连接,使用php表单(带有用户和传递文本输入)是完全不安全的:这是可行的,但不安全:因此,我阅读了有关mysqli_real_escape_string的信息,并决定尝试一下:这是正确的吗?这是如何使用mysqli_real_escape_string的一个很好的例子吗? 最佳答案 Isthiscorrect?是的。这个孤立的精选示例是安全的。这并不意味着,不过,mysqli_real_escape_string应该被视为一个旨在防止SQL注入(inject)的函数。因为在这个例子中,它只是在意外
我正在寻找一个很好的教程,它描述了如何创建自己的完整mysqli连接类,可能演示了如何捕获和所有这些好东西。如果你想知道,我实际上已经做了一些我自己的搜索,但我没有找到任何真正详细的文章。,谢谢。 最佳答案 到目前为止,这是对我帮助最大的一个。但是……我同意……到目前为止我所看到的一切都不是很容易理解的。我有点沮丧。http://www.databasejournal.com/features/mysql/article.php/3599166/Connecting-and-prepared-statements-with-the-
我正在查看我的代码并读到它被推荐使用mysqli_free_result当不再需要您的结果对象时。但是在看到每个查询在整个脚本中重复输出到$result变量后,我想知道mysqli_free_result是否真的有必要。似乎每次运行查询时,$result变量都已被清除并设置为新结果。只是好奇是否有人对此有任何意见。 最佳答案 其实是有必要的,因为当有很多请求时,它可能会给服务器带来沉重的负担。因此,最好您应该使用它。在其他一些情况下,当您知道此查询后跟其他查询时,您不必使用它。 关于ph
我是第一次尝试使用mySQLi。在循环的情况下我已经做到了。循环结果正在显示,但是当我尝试显示单个记录时我被卡住了。这是正在运行的循环代码。Name:Email:如何从第一行或其他任何地方显示一条记录、任何记录、姓名或电子邮件,仅显示一条记录,我该怎么做?在单个记录的情况下,考虑删除所有上述循环部分,让我们显示没有循环的任何单个记录。 最佳答案 当只需要一个结果时,不应使用循环。立即获取该行。如果您需要将整行提取到关联数组中:$row=$result->fetch_assoc();如果您只需要一个值$row=$result->fet
我有办法获取表格列的名称。它工作正常但现在我想更新到新的mysqli?(我尝试了mysqli_fetch_field但我不知道如何应用于这种情况,我不确定它是否是wright选项)如何对mysqli做同样的事情?:$sql="SELECT*frommyTable";$result=mysql_query($sql,$con);$id=mysql_field_name($result,0);$a=mysql_field_name($result,1);echo$id;echo$a; 最佳答案 这是实现这个缺失函数的方法:functio